What is MI-03A-09
The Michigan Notice of Commencement Form is a legal document used by property owners to notify lien claimants about the initiation of improvement work.

Understanding the -03A-09 form
The MI-03A-09 form serves a critical role in the construction process for homeowners in Michigan. It acts as a legal notification, known as a Notice of Commencement, marking the beginning of construction work. This notification is essential not only for lien claimants but also for potential property buyers, as it helps establish a formal record of the project.
Why is the -03A-09 Form Important?
-
The form provides legal protection to homeowners and ensures that contractors and subcontractors can file liens.
-
It enhances transparency for property buyers regarding any encumbrances on the property.

Who is required to sign the Michigan Notice of Commencement Form?
The homeowner or lessee must sign the Michigan Notice of Commencement Form. Notaries are also required to verify the signature, while the General Contractor's signature is not mandatory.
When should the form be submitted?
The Michigan Notice of Commencement Form must be completed and submitted within 10 days of the request to avoid potential expenses related to the project.
What happens if I fail to return the form on time?
Failure to return the form within the specified 10-day period may expose homeowners to additional expenses or complications in lien claims related to the property improvements.

Is notarization required for this form?
Yes, notarization is required for the Michigan Notice of Commencement Form to ensure its legal validity and compliance with state regulations.
